摘要

Different types of thrust vector control systems are described, and a comparison of present systems is presented. Confined jet thrust vector control is shown to be an effective alternative. A two-dimensional nozzle that operates as a confined jet thrust vector control nozzle is experimentally demonstrated. Effects of changing geometric variables and inputs on ease of vectoring and performance of vectored thrust are analyzed. Schlieren photographs and movies show flow characteristics. Predictions of performance of operable nozzles are made based on results found in the experiments. Recommendations for further study are made.
